Le Meridien Commodore concludes its total makeover...

 

Le Meridien Commodore is renowned for the good reputation, it holds a nostalgia that will never fade, especially when it keeps up to the expectations of its audience through a total renovation adding a modern luxurious look to one of the cities most fabulous hotels.

Following the renovation that took place at Le Méridien Commodore lately, through which a new elegant look was added, another change is yet to come involving an enlargement of The Lounge Bar.

The Lounge Bar, covering a part of the lobby, is intended to overtake a gift shop area and hence add to the warm and spacious lobby an extra dimension.

This change, the latest phase of the renovation, will introduce a new space overlooking the sidewalk, near the hotel entrance, allowing a lot of light into the Bar and Lobby during the day as well as introducing a special atmosphere in the evenings.

Places of Interest in Lebanon

  • Downtown Beirut – chic shopping district, sidewalk cafés, refined restaurants, buzzing nightspots and Roman ruins
  • Jeita Grotto – a natural wonder
  • Byblos (Jbeil) – the world’s oldest port city and birthplace of the alphabet
  • Anjar – site of a magnificent Byzantine ruin
  • Baalbeck – The ruins of three Roman temples
  • The Cedars – ancient, living wonders
  • Tyre – Ancient Phoenician port town and an old traditional souk
